Several short-acting β-adrenergic receptor blocking agents have been prepared by incorporating ester functions into the aryl portion of certain (aryloxy)propanolamine systems.In particular, methyl 3-<4-<2-hydroxy-3-(isopropylamino)propoxy>phenyl>propionate hydrochloride (ASL-8052) was found to be a moderately potent, cardioselective compound with a short duration of action when determined in in vivo canine models.
